September 15th, 1997, Royal Albert Hall, London, UK On September 15th, 1997, Royal Albert Hall in London
was the venue for the benefit concert Music for Montserrat, organized
by Sir George and Lady Martin together with Harvey Goldsmith to raise
money to help the victims of the Soufriere Volcano on
Montserrat’s island erupting since mid 1993, Mark Knopfler and
Eric Clapton were two of the many guest artists for this event, Mark
Knopfler played the Wild Theme with Guy Fletcher, but was edited out
the VHS and DVD, I like this Wild Theme very much because mark did not
play his Red Strat, he used his Les Paul and the sound and feeling of
the song is very unique, really beautiful, judge by yourselves. On
this CD are only the songs they played whether together or by
themselves, I have not included the ones where they were part of the
band for someone else.
